Prime Electric Named #1 Best Place To Work In Washington

by Riley Yale, Marketing Manager | Aug 21, 2026 | Articles, Awards

 

Prime Electric is proud to announce that we have been named the #1 Best Place to Work in Washington by the Puget Sound Business Journal (PSBJ) in the Extra Large Company category (500+ employees). Based on employee feedback, Prime earned the top ranking among large employers across the state, reflecting the people-first culture that has fueled our growth and success for decades

At Prime, we invest in our team members through health and wellness programs, career development opportunities, community involvement initiatives, employee resource groups, and programs that foster connection and support across the organization. From mentorship and education to scholarships, volunteer opportunities, and wellness events, we are committed to helping our people grow both personally and professionally.

“What makes Prime special is the way our employees look out for one another, embrace our values, and take pride in the work they do. We’ve built a culture centered on safety, growth, opportunity, and respect. Being recognized as the #1 Best Place to Work reinforces our commitment to putting people first.”

Oliver Whitehead

President, Prime Electric

Anonymos survey feedback from PBSJ highlights the impact of that commitment. One Prime team member shared how they entered the industry with little experience and quickly found opportunities to learn, grow, and build a successful career. Another highlighted the support she received as a working mother of a special-needs child while continuing to advance her career. Employees also consistently praised Prime’s commitment to safety and ensuring every team member returns Home Safe, Every Day.

 “This recognition is part of a larger story across Prime. From Best Places to Work honors in Sacramento and Portland to a Top 10 ranking in the Bay Area, these achievements reflect the strong culture our teams have built across every region. While each market is unique, our commitment to supporting our people remains the same. Of all our achievements during this period of growth, this one makes me the proudest because it comes directly from our team members.”

Bob Ledford

CEO, Prime Electric

Being named the #1 Best Place to Work in Washington is both an honor and a reflection of the culture our team members help create every day. As Prime continues to grow, we remain committed to investing in our people, strengthening our culture, and creating meaningful career opportunities. To every team member who shared feedback and helps make Prime an exceptional workplace, thank you.
